
Does Revolutionary Care Act Have Technology Support?
The new Care Act, which became law a few weeks ago, was described to me recently by a campaigner for disabled people as “the most revolutionary change in care legislation for decades”. For once, it appears as if the rhetoric of the politicians was right. The act now makes it a statutory requirement that everyone who is in the care system has to have an assessment of their needs; and as a result a personalised care plan.
